The Three Lonely Old Men

The three lonely old men, pictured above, are happy to announce that a few weeks ago, Alan Johnson became mobile again which meant, of course, that he was able to make his way to the Griffin once more to join the almost despairing threesome who have kept a steady, weekly vigil at the altar of the famous Porter brewing establishment. Much earlier this year and at the back end of the last, it really was a desperate situation when the lonely three were reduced to an even lonelier two for almost three months. Frank had deserted them for the sunnier climes of the Antipodes where he and his wife were visiting their son and generally touring the southern hemisphere.

With Frank back and Alan joining us, our cup runneth over. This does not of course mean that we are any less lonely - it just means that there are more of us to get to that hapless state. We will bite the bullet and continue the thankless task of keeping the corner seats warm on a Tuesday night.
